Prairie Township is a township in Jewell County, Kansas, USA. As of the 2000 census, its population was 172.

Geography[edit]

Prairie Township covers an area of 37.05 square miles (95.95 square kilometers); of this, 0.01 square miles (0.01 square kilometers) or 0.01 percent is water. The streams of Dry Creek, Dry Creek, East Buffalo Creek, Spring Creek and West Buffalo Creek run through this township.

Cemeteries[edit]

The township contains two cemeteries: Pleasant Prairie and Star.
